This book summarizes the proceedings of the National Lord's Day Convention, a gathering of religious leaders seeking to promote the sanctification of the Lord's Day (Sunday). The author provides an abstract of the convention's proceedings, including resolutions passed and speeches given by prominent figures of the time. The convention's goal was to promote the idea that Sunday should be a day for spiritual reflection and worship, rather than one for worldly activities. The book includes a variety of perspectives on the topic, offering readers a comprehensive view of the arguments for and against Sunday observance. Through these discussions, the book highlights the importance of religious freedom and the role of government in protecting religious practices.
